Valid passport or passport replacing documents are required. Visa not required.
Those with UK passports endorsed 'British Citizen' require a passport valid for 6 months beyond the period of intended stay, but no visa is required for touristic stays of 90 days. Those with any other endorsement should check official requirements.
Canadian citizens require a passport valid for period of intended stay. No visa is required.
Australian citizens require a passport valid for period of intended stay. A visa is not required for stays of up to 90 days.
South Africans must hold a passport valid for period of intended stay and a visa is also required, unless holding a valid US visa.
New Zealand nationals require a passport valid for the period of intended stay. A visa is not required for touristic stays up to 90 days.
Irish citizens require a passport valid for the period of intended stay. No visa is required for stays of up to 90 days.
All passport holders must have an onward or return ticket and documents necessary for further travel. Entry requirements for Puerto Rico are the same as for the United States of America. When arriving from mainland USA there is no immigration control. It is highly recommended that passports have at least six months validity remaining after your intended date of departure from your travel destination. Immigration officials often apply different rules to those stated by travel agents and official sources._Note: Passport and visa requirements are liable to change at short notice. Travellers are advised to check their entry requirements with their embassy or consulate.
